Transaction db51a57da19ebaafad051092519e683859a0ecda4a00cc6f59786ff51e755fa6
1 Input
1 Output
-
db51a57da19ebaafad051092519e683859a0ecda4a00cc6f59786ff51e755fa6:0
- value
- 356821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c07abbe400a045523eaf43f3045cbd23c730719b OP_EQUAL
- address
- 3KEkh5ZK8fvERZ67FTcVo7teGQTYKbTDS8